What is the role of epidermis in plants?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

It protects internal tissues against mechanical injury, parasitic fungi, bacteria and also from cold or heat. Thick cuticle, wax, epidermal hair and multiple epidermis reduce loss of water from internal tissue. Epidermal cells of roots have hairs that greatly increase the absorptive surface areas for the absorption of water and nutrients.
